Best time to go to Sablet

If you're planning a trip to Sablet,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is July. Peak season runs from June to August, while off-peak times, like January and October to November tend to have fewer bookings and better deals.

Exploring the natural features in Sablet

Whether you're an active traveler or just want to appreciate the scenery, Sablet is a great place to get outside. These are a few of the area's most eye-catching sights, all within 30 miles (48.2 km) of the city center:

  • Dentelles de Montmirail (2.8 mi / 4.5 km)
  • Les Gorges Du Toulourenc (9.7 mi / 15.7 km)
  • Mont Ventoux (13.5 mi / 21.8 km)
  • Regional Natural Park of Baronnies Provençales (24.9 mi / 40.1 km)
  • Le Parc Alexis Gruss (8.2 mi / 13.2 km)
  • Salettes Lake (12.6 mi / 20.3 km)

How to get to and around Sablet

Fly into Avignon (AVN-Caumont), the closest airport, located 20.5 mi (33.1 km) from the city center.

What are the top attractions in Sablet?
In Sablet, travelers can immerse themselves in the charm of this picturesque Provençal village, where the narrow streets are lined with traditional stone houses and vibrant flower-filled gardens. The local market, held weekly, offers a delightful array of fresh produce, artisan goods, and local delicacies, making it a must-visit for food enthusiasts.

Nearby, the stunning vineyards of the Côtes du Rhône region provide opportunities for wine tasting and tours, allowing visitors to explore the rich flavors of the region. The historic architecture of Sablet includes the beautiful church of Saint-Étienne, which adds to the village's quaint atmosphere.

For those interested in outdoor activities, the surrounding countryside is superb for hiking and biking, with scenic trails that showcase the breathtaking landscapes of Provence.
